
Yeferson Gaviria developed a secure authentication and user registration system for the Eureka-projectFactoriaF5/buzon-inteligente-BE repository, establishing a robust JWT-based security core and integrating end-to-end onboarding workflows. He applied Java, Spring Boot, and SQL to design and implement features such as token management, profile and locker modeling, and data initialization. His work included refactoring controllers, enhancing error handling, and enforcing data integrity through unique constraints and improved DTO mappings. By resolving repository inconsistencies and optimizing entity relationships, Yeferson delivered a maintainable backend foundation that streamlines onboarding, strengthens security, and supports future scalability for the project’s evolving requirements.
